Question 1116774: The area of the rubber coating for a flat roof was 96 ft^2. The rectangular frame the carpenter built for the flat roof has dimensions such that the length us 4 feet longer than the width. What are the dimensions of the frame?

w, width
w+4, length

w%28w%2B4%29=96
-
Simple arithmetic knowledge possible - find two factors of 96 which differ by 4. Look at list of all combinations of two factors.


Otherwise, the another way can be this:
w%5E2%2B4w-96=0
%28w-8%29%28w%2B12%29=0
-
system%28w=8%2Cand%2Cw%2B4=12%29

Length 12
Width 8
